Transaction 24fd0e130b46a18debbee1aff7da419ed7c79768d576610a0b358a9c4059f9ba
1 Input
1 Output
-
24fd0e130b46a18debbee1aff7da419ed7c79768d576610a0b358a9c4059f9ba:0
- value
- 3481626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e04613f45a938c42b143a0a8852d15b55307607c OP_EQUAL
- address
- 3N8sEccoMhgKRTUZ6i1qiHe9FAeFGQDPYi